  4. BeagleBoy on June 4th, 2010 7:49 pm

    Inkjets Feedback: All photos and all the colors can be made with the 3 basic Cyan, Magenta and Yellow colors.

    Some photo printers have more colors like Light Cyan, Light Magenta, Grey, etc. These typically just give more gamut and a slightly wider range of colors so that you see less graininess as the color transitions.

    An example would be using just the black cartridge to print grey. You’d print less and less ink and the color looks more greyish. But if you had a grey cartridge, then your color transition would look smoother as you can mix more color combinations.
